US Patent 8981273 Optical frequency tracking and stabilization based on extra-cavity frequency

Patent 8981273 was granted and assigned to Ram Photonics LLC on March, 2015 by the United States Patent and Trademark Office.

Patent abstract

Embodiments of the invention provides methods and systems for synthesizing optical signals with high frequency stability. Using a set of external optical signal manipulators and control systems, embodiments of the invention enhance the resolution of any frequency reference and thereby alleviates the needs for ultra-high-Q cavities in frequency-stable optical signal synthesis. The invention consequently improves the performance of any optical signal generator by a substantial margin, while maintaining the system complexity and power dissipation at levels comparable to the original systems.
